What is Chewy and How Does It Work?

Chewy is an online retailer dedicated to pet products. Founded in 2011, it quickly became a go-to source for pet owners across the United States. The platform offers a vast selection of items, including food, toys, grooming supplies, and health-related products.

Shopping on Chewy is straightforward. Users can browse through categories or search for specific brands. Once you find what you need, adding items to your cart is just a click away.

Chewy also features autoship options that allow customers to schedule regular deliveries of essential supplies. This means no more last-minute trips to the store when you’re running low on dog food or cat litter.

With competitive pricing and frequent discounts available, Chewy attracts both budget-conscious shoppers and those looking for quality products alike. Their user-friendly website makes it easy to manage your orders with just a few taps or clicks.

The Benefits of Using Chewy for Pet Needs

Chewy offers a vast selection of pet products, catering to dogs, cats, and various other pets. This extensive inventory makes it easy to find everything you need in one place.

Shopping is convenient with their user-friendly website and mobile app. You can browse categories or search for specific products quickly.

One standout feature is the autoship option, which allows customers to schedule regular deliveries of essential items like food or medication. This service helps ensure you never run out of what your furry friend needs.

Chewy also prides itself on excellent customer service. Their team is available 24/7 via chat or phone, ready to assist with any inquiries.

Additionally, Chewy often runs promotions and discounts that make purchasing pet supplies more affordable than traditional retail stores. It’s an appealing choice for budget-conscious pet owners seeking quality products.

The Drawbacks of Using Chewy

While Chewy offers a wide range of products, it’s not without its drawbacks. Shipping delays can sometimes occur, particularly during peak seasons or unexpected events. This may leave you in a bind if your pet needs supplies urgently.

Pricing is another consideration. While many items are competitively priced, some products can be more expensive compared to local stores or other online retailers. It’s essential to compare prices before making bulk purchases.

Additionally, customer service experiences can vary. Some users report quick and helpful responses while others have faced difficulties getting timely support for their issues.

The website’s user experience might feel overwhelming with numerous options available. Navigating through countless brands and products could lead to decision fatigue for busy pet owners seeking convenience.

Alternatives to Chewy for Pet Supplies

When considering alternatives to Chewy, a few options stand out in the pet products business. Amazon offers a vast selection of pet supplies with competitive pricing. Their Prime membership can also speed up delivery, which is appealing for those who need items quickly.

Petco and PetSmart have brick-and-mortar locations alongside their online stores. This allows customers to browse products physically or pick up orders without waiting for shipping.

Another noteworthy contender is Wag.com, which specializes in pet food and supplies with an easy-to-navigate website. They often provide discounts on bulk purchases.

Don’t overlook local businesses either; many offer unique products and personalized service that larger retailers may lack. Supporting these shops can enhance your community while fulfilling your pet needs efficiently.

FAQs

What is Chewy and what products does it sell?

Chewy is an online pet retailer that offers pet food, treats, toys, grooming products, medications, healthcare items, and accessories for dogs, cats, birds, fish, and other pets.

Is Chewy cheaper than buying pet supplies in stores?

In many cases, Chewy offers competitive pricing, subscription discounts through Autoship, and regular promotions. However, prices can vary depending on the product and retailer.

What is Chewy Autoship and is it worth using?

Autoship allows customers to schedule recurring deliveries of pet essentials while receiving additional discounts on eligible products. It is particularly useful for pet owners who regularly purchase food, litter, or medications.

What are the best alternatives to Chewy?

Popular alternatives include Amazon, Petco, PetSmart, and local pet supply stores. The right choice depends on pricing, product availability, delivery speed, and customer service preferences.
